I've seen this mentioned a few times, is it common that the company awards a new category while a pilot is under a seat lock?? It seems like it would be really rare but I have no idea. Just curious, thanks.
#4442
Yes rare, but it has happened. The last time that I know of was a few years ago with the 7ER I believe. It's just one of those you can win if you don't play kind of things.
